Safirul@Saddam Hossain v. The State Of West Bengal And ANR
27.09.2023.
Item No. 6 Court No.1 ap CALCUTTA HIGH COURT
IN THE CIRCUIT BENCH AT JALPAIGURI
APPELLATE SIDE C.R.M. (DB) No. 617 of 2023 In Re:- An application for bail under Section 439 of the Code of Criminal Procedure, 1973 filed on 21.09.2023 in connection with Mathabanga Police Station Case No. 385 of dated 22.07.2023 under Sections 406/417/376(2)(n) of the Indian Penal Code.
And In the matter of: Safirul @ Saddam Hossain. ...petitioner Mr. Subhasish Misra, Mr. Swarup Das, Mr. Satyajit Paul.
...For the petitioner Mr. Aditi Shankar Chakraborty, Mr. Ujjwal Luksom, Mr. Sagnik Sankar Sikdar. ....For the State
1. The application for bail has been taken out on several grounds and the petitioner is in custody since 23rd July, 2023.
2. This Court has considered the complaint of the victim and statement under Section 164 of the Code of Criminal Procedure.
3. It appears that there was a consensual physical relation between the petitioner and the victim girl for a period of three years on a promise to marry her. It further appears that trial has commenced and charge-sheet has been filed under Sections 406/376(2)(n) read with Section 417 of the Indian Penal Code.
4. This Court does not wish to elaborate further on the other parts of the statements as it may prejudice both the prosecution as well as the accused person in the trial.
5. In view of the above, since the physical relations was consensual on a promise to marry between the petitioner and the victim girl, this Court is of the view that the petitioner is entitled to bail.
6. Let the petitioner be released on bail upon furnishing bond of Rs.10,000/- with two sureties of Rs.5,000/- each, one of whom must be local, to the satisfaction of the Learned Additional Sessions Judge, Mathabanga, Cooch Behar.
7. It is further directed that after release, the petitioner shall attend the jurisdictional Court when the matter is fixed for hearing.
8. We make it clear that if the petitioner fails to make himself available before the Trial Court, the Trial Court shall have the liberty to cancel the bail granted to the petitioner and take him into custody without any further reference to this Court.
9. C.R.M. (DB) No. 617 of 2023 is, thus, allowed and disposed of.
